The Army Corps’ New England District Planning Division performed maintenance dredging which hydraulically removed approximately 118,000 cubic yards of sand from Cape Cod Canal.

The sand was then pumped onto Town Neck Beach in Sandwich, MA. Additional sand will be placed on Town Neck Beach as part of the Cape Cod Canal Section 111 Shore Damage Mitigation Project.

This project will provide further shoreline protection to Town Neck Beach along with the 600+ acre salt marsh behind it. Up to 387,000 cubic yards will be dredged from the Scusset Borrow Site, off of Scusset Beach Reservation, and placed onto the beach.

A dune and berm will be constructed on Town Neck Beach as part of the project to protect the beach’s properties and natural resources.

USACE is currently in the design phase for the project with construction expected to begin in October 2024.
